About the role
The Ontario Public Service (OPS) is a professional, non-partisan organization of over 60,000 public servants who support the Government of Ontario in developing and delivering policies and programs that serve the public interest. With a broad mandate that spans areas such as policy, communications, and program delivery, the OPS is committed to excellence, innovation, and public accountability. Leadership roles within the OPS offer the opportunity to shape outcomes that have a lasting impact on communities across the province.
The OPS is seeking a Deputy Minister of Transportation, with proven strategic and innovative thinking to drive change, improve outcomes and achieve greater efficiencies for the people of Ontario. The Ontario Ministry of Transportation (MTO) strives to be a world leader in moving people and goods safely, efficiently and sustainably to support a globally competitive economy and a high quality of life. The Ministry supports Ontario’s economic competitiveness by planning and investing in critical transportation infrastructure, vital gateways, ferries and border crossings. Its goals include promoting road safety and transit ridership, and integrating sustainability into the Ontario government’s decision-making, programs, policies and operations.
The Deputy Minister serves as a strategic leader and catalyst for transformation, working closely with the Minister and government to advance policy and deliver on key priorities that enhance the well-being of Ontarians. This role demands a proven track record of executive leadership, operational excellence, financial stewardship, and the ability to foster effective public-private partnerships. Ideal candidates will demonstrate entrepreneurial vision, innovative thinking, and deep credibility with stakeholders across transportation sectors. Exceptional negotiation, communication, and change leadership capabilities are essential to drive performance, improve outcomes, and lead in complexity.
